Dave has announced an exclusive 10-part tech series starring comedian Marcus Brigstocke and his best friend, actor and presenter Alexis Conran.

The Joy of Techs will see technophobe Marcus and gadget-obsessed Alexis (Hustle, The Real Hustle) travel the UK completing challenges and activities, taking both old-fashioned and technologically-advanced approaches. Alexis tries to convince Marcus tech is the way forward, while Marcus will do everything to prove the original way is best.

One episode sees the pair go low and high-tech camping, and UKTV bosses have revealed we will also see solar powered cars and flying bikes on the show.

Brigstocke said, “Even if we needed half the so called 'life-hack' crap they produce - most of it is so complicated it rarely works.

“In the Joy of Techs I will take great pleasure in demonstrating to Alexis that it's a waste of time and money.

“I'll tell you a good bit of tech - the zip. That works.”

Conran said: “I’m not worried about our friendship suffering on this show, as we can both be stubborn and argumentative, but I do worry about killing ourselves trying to prove our point!”

The Joy of Techs will be produced by Blink Films and will air in 2017.
